Изъясняйтесь внятно. тогда и проблемы будут отсутсвовать.
"Формирование счета" - это что? ОСВ по счету? карточка счета? анализ счета? печатная форма документа "счет"? В какой именно момент возникает задержка? НЕ ЖЛОБТЕСЬ! Опишите подробно! Омон к вам не собирается.
Попробуйте: удалите на клиенте ВСЕ НЕСУЩЕСТВУЮЩИЕ принтеры.
Принтеров всего 3 -по умолчанию, PDF Creator и Microsoft XPS Document Writer. Все они были и раньше, все работало норм.
Я могу путаться, потому что я сис. админ, а не спец по 1С. Просто пытаюсь помочь людям.
В общем как мне объяснили:
В общем журнале документов, например, нужно найтиранее сформированный счет и открыть его. Так вот он его долго долго ищет при вводе первых символов, а потом еще долго долго открывает, может 15 мин и больше. Это все про клиента. К базе он подключается через разшаренную папку на сервере. Что можно сделать?
перейти на работу через удаленный рабочий стол. увеличить оперативку на сервере из расчета 256 МБт на каждый сеанс 1с. Очистить лог файл
взлет обеспечен
удалите XPS Document Writer, если не используете, он часто вызывает тормоза компьютера. Сеть не по wi-fi сделана? По wi-fi 7.7 работает медленно, особенно если база большая.
(8) AlexInqMetal, нет, сеть через роутер. Просто раньше все довольно быстро работало, тем более, что компьютеры в одном кабинете. А поможет вот эта утилита?
http://infostart.ru/public/16532/ Заранее всем огромное спасибо
Так как вы Сисадмин, то ваша задача сделать "шуструю" сеть или более правильный вариант в этом случае - загнать всех пользователей в терминал (на сервер)
(17) swi76,
Верная вещь,1cv7.cfg, файл настроек, за долгое время работы становится размером в несколько мегабайт, там мульоны записей, и прога , обращаясь к нему, перебирает(я думаю, весьма неоптимально и долго) его весь...Поэтому при открытии базы(информационный блок), регламентированных отчётов и прочего, идёт постоянное обращение к этому файлу и база ощутимо виснет...я его сносил, просто, всё начинало летать
Когда то делал небольшую сеть (где то 40 машин).
Всё сетевое оборудование 3com (карточки в машинах и роутер). Сеть сдал.
Проходит месяц. Звонит клиент: "Сеть практически не работает".
Прихожу. Смотрю. Тормоза жуткие. Мелкие файлы копируются по пару минут.
Бился почти неделю. Оказалось они купили еще один компьютер. В нем карточка - Реалтек.
Выключаешь этот компьютер - и все опять нормально.
Это по поводу - телепатов. Их здесь нет.
Просто файлы по сети (в папку с базой) копируются (туда-оттуда) с рабочего места клиента нормально?
Эта проблема на одном рабочем месте? Если - да (значит проблема на нем), если нет, скорее всего, на сервере
Перед замедлением работы - ставились (удалялись) программы?
Папка с прогрммой 1С и с базой - в исключениях антивируса? На антивирусе клиента стоит опция "проверять сетевые подключения/ сетевые диски)?
Затормаживание обращения к БД
1.проверить досточность оперативки(256мб)
2.сделать тестирование и исправление, упаковкой таблиц(заранее снять копию бд))
3.на диске с операционкой должно быть сводного место мин 10Гб(для файлов подкачки)
4.Если все это не помогает проверяй жесткие диски на наличие ошибок
большое торможение БД зависит от объема базы, сколько места занимает на Жестком?
Сетевые карты, чистка файлов и прочее - это все не то. Если я правильно понял, то у вас работают не в терминалке, а через шару базы по сети. Так вот. При таком режиме работы вы практически ничем не ускорите работу, никакими чистками и настройками. 1С так устроена, что начинает дико тормозить при работе через шару, когда в нее заходит уже 2 пользователь.
Единственный выход - это именно терминальный сервер, как вам ответили в 18. Когда то и я к этому пришел) Все будет просто летать.
Сеть - wifi (роутер TP-LINK и usb адаптеры - 3 шт от того же производителя (150МБит)).
База на компе, соединенном с роутером LAN кабелем.
Первый юзер - на ура, второй и следующие - с дикими тормозами.
Где копать?
Почистил компы антивирем: кое-где нашлось порядка 5-6 проблем (NOD32).
На компе главбуха, где стоит база, - Win XP, на остальных Win 7.
Памяти на компе у ГБ - 2 ГБ, место на ЖД - достаточно.
По их же сообщениям, база (установлена неделю назад) - работла 3-4 дня нормально, затем начались тормоза (говорят, что после выключения света).
В аналогичных вариантах файловая база 7.7 (в основном по кабелю) работала(ет) на ура.
В чем м.б. проблемы?
Антивирь у ГБ - Dr.Web, в остальных местах - NOD 32.
(27) Serge_ASB,
Поддерживаю Cooler-а.
1. Пользователи "врут", что раньше работало быстро.
2. Wi-Fi сеть для 1С в режиме "файл-сервера" - это удачный инструмент для "выкачивания денег" из заказчиков за постоянное тестирование, исправление проблем по сети. "150МБит" - это при лабораторных условиях, реально сколько вы проверяли?
3. Вы ничего не сказали про настройку антивирусов. Вообще, читали предыдущие сообщения в этой ветке?
4. Настолько разные операционные системы. Я когда принтеры настраиваю в подобной связке разных ОС, то вспоминаю почти весь запас матерных выражений.
Мои предложения и "вольный перевод" предложений от Cooler-а:
1. Базу перенести на нормальной серверную операционку. Понимаю, что "Windows XP" у бухгалтера - это видимо желание не получить проблемы с электронной отчетностью и (или) клиент-банком.
2. Все компьютеры подключить через "кабели".
(36) l_user,
Кабель - как вариант. Буду пробовать.
Может, сделать так: 3 компа соединить кабелем в роутер, и Главбуха - через Wifi - туда же?
Win XP там мтоит, т.к. комп - самый древний. Может, кстати, и винду переустановить?
7-ка пойдет или нет - ХЗ, а вот поставить XP SP3 года 2008-2010 - может помочь, наверное.
На всех компах, кроме главбуха, стоит NOD32 (у ГБ - Dr.Web)
(37) Serge_ASB,
1. Всех нужно соединить кабелем с роутером!!!
2. Переустановка Windows XP на Windows XP не поможет.
3. Про антивирус: в настройках исключите проверки каталогов, где лежит база "1С".
Ещё вариант- сервер подключить физическим кабелем, причём покороче, хотя 0.5 метра по минимуму может не хватить для нормального расположения роутера. Тогда будет одно затухание сигнала, а не два.
И надо смотреть конфигурацию помещения, может у них даже лабиринт, где будет пропадать сигнал.
причём покороче, хотя 0.5 метра по минимуму может не хватить для нормального расположения роутера. Тогда будет одно затухание сигнала, а не два
Вах щайтанама!
Еще нужно обязательно использовать UTP с диаметром жилы 0,5 или 0,6 мм - в 0,4 мм большие IP-пакеты не влезают, поэтому пока база маленькая - все работает, а когда база растет - начинает тормозить! И строго медный - на омедненном алюминии скорость передачи IP-пакетов по центру жилы и по поверхности различна, что применительно к базам данных может вызвать рассогласование индексов и крах базы.
Помещение - не лабиринт - одно общее, разграниченное перегородками: аллюминиевые рамы со стекляными "окнами". Высота метра полтора.
Если базу перенести на другой комп (где, стоит Win 7), тормозит при втором юзере, но, кажется, меньше.
Каюинет главбуха - в торце помещения. Роутер - там же.
Может, вынести роутер ближе к людям, и поставить ГБ тоже wifi адаптер?
Второй вопрос, если настроить sql, будет быстрее? Не совсем понял, из мануалов в инете, как правильно положить базу 1С 7.7 под sql (и как потом ее конфигурировать).
(32) Cooler, вообще, у меня 1С под SQL. Во-вторых, SQL сервер - сам по себе допускает Free лицензию. В-третьих, я просил подсказать конструктивно, по настройке работы. Вопросы взаимодействия с прочими структурами - уже дело не первого порядка (тем более, что я не в РФ живу).
SQL не дает революционного прироста в скорости, она дает надежность хранения данных и снимает ограничения на размер DBF.
Для использования десктопной ОС в качестве сервера ее надо как минимум сконфигурировать, либо ручной правкой реестра (ключи искать лениво), либо то же самое автоматом при помощи утилиты ConfigNT.
Но по-настоящему "чтобы АХ!" даст только терминал, если нет денег на покупку даже Viterminal, то смотрите в сторону незаконного TS-Free.
На скуле будет быстрее работать при обработке больших объемов данных, если правильно запросы под скуль адаптировать. Но отчет с разворотом до регистратора производительностью не порадуют
Кстати, последовав советам из Инета:
- менял на "c:\temp" (а затем убрал вовсе) временные папки для пользователей
- Пересоздавал базу через Выгрузить - Загрузить из раздела Администрирование
- переносил базы на другой комп (где стоит Win 7 x64)
В последнем случае стала работать шустрее. Не настолько, что АХ, но лучше.
Еще советовали на диске, где стоит база, убрать кеширование... сейчас попробую.
Может, еще и роутер поднести к компу с базой (куда перенес сейчас)?
1. Сделать выгрузить загрузить, чтобы почистить все таблицы
2. Сделать тестирование и исправление чтобы убрать бытые ссылки и тд
3. Если данных дофига сделать свертку
4. Если пользователей дофига перейти на SQl
Перенес роутер на компьютер, который побыстрее, соединил 2 компа проводом.
С третьего стало побыстрее малость (субъективно).
Ком Главбуха прицепил по WiFi (он и без того - не новый и сам по себе подтормаживает: зашлю специально обученного человека посмотреть/почистить/переустановить).
С другой стороны: в большом офисе (машин на 50) есть сегмент сети под wifi, и там все работает без тормозов...